India's Mining Sector: Towards a Sustainable and Equitable Future

  The introduction of the Environment Protection Act (EPA), 1986 (amended in 2006) and the Forest (Conservation) Act, 1980 aimed at monitoring mining activities for the protection of the environment during all the phases of a mineral resource extraction cycle including planning, production process, and closure.

Environment Protection Act and Key Rules - Somaiya

Environment Protection Act and Rules, 1986 Stringent Penalties and Punishments Whoever contravenes the provisions of the Act- maximum punishment up to 7 years and penalty up to Rs. 1 lakh or Rs. 5000 per day for continued offence. (S-15) For defaulter Companies or Body Corporates- Directors or partners are prosecuted. (S-16)

CPCB Central Pollution Control Board

The Environment (Protection) Act was enacted in 1986 with the objective of providing for the protection and improvement of the environment. It empowers the Central Government to establish authorities [under section 3(3)] charged with the mandate of preventing environmental pollution in all its forms and to tackle specific environmental problems

Environment Protection under Constitutional Framework of India

The Environment (Protection) Act, 1986 defines environment as “environment includes water, air and land and the interrelationship which exists among and between air, water and land and human beings, other living creatures, plants, micro-organism and property”.
